Since 1977, the Woodside Homes name has been synonymous with integrity, excellence, and design innovation. As one of America's top 30 homebuilders, we are committed to providing the knowledge, experience, and processes that encourage our customers to realize their ideal lifestyle.

Now, Woodside has found its place to call home as part of Sekisui House. Founded in 1960, Sekisui House, Ltd. is one of the world’s largest homebuilders and an internationally diversified developer, with cumulative sales of over 2.6 million homes. Based in Osaka, Japan, Sekisui House has over 300 consolidated subsidiaries and affiliates, over 29,000 employees, and is list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ange and Nagoya Stock Exchange.
